﻿@charset "utf-8";
/* CSS Document */



*{margin:0;padding:0;list-style-type:none;border:0;}
table{empty-cells:show;border-collapse:collapse;border-spacing:0;} 
h1{font-size:18px; font-weight:normal;} h2{ font-size:28px; font-weight:normal;} h3,h4{font-size:14px; font-weight:normal;} h5,h6{font-size:12px; font-weight:normal;}
abbr,acronym{border:0;font-variant:normal} 
address,caption,cite,code,dfn,th,var,optgroup,i,b,em,small,strong,ins,tt,big,p{font-weight:normal; font-size:12px; font-style:normal; text-decoration:none;}
input,button,textarea,select,optgroup,option{font-family:inherit;font-size:inherit;font-style:inherit;font-weight:inherit}
input,button,textarea,select{*font-size:100%}
a{ text-decoration:none; color:#555;}
a:hover{ text-decoration:underline;}
.clear{display:block;overflow:hidden;clear:both;height:0;line-height:0; font-size:0; width:100%;}
body{margin: 0px auto; padding: 0px; font-family:"微软雅黑" ; font-size: 12px; color:#555; width: 100%; height: 100%; background:#fff;}
html{overflow-x:hidden;}
strong{ font-weight:bold;font-size:14px; color:#555;}

#top{ width:100%; float:left; height:167px; background:#f9f9f9; overflow:hidden;}
.top{ width:100%; float:left; height:119px;}
.top1{ width:1003px; height:119px; margin:0 auto; }
.top2{ width:483px; float:left; height:47px; padding-top:49px;}
.top3{ width:240px; float:right; height:119px;}
.top4{ width:240px; float:right; margin-top:6px;}
.top4 p{ color:#555; line-height:17px; float:right;}
.top5{ width:245px; float:left; padding-top:30px;}
.top5 span{ width:42px; height:43px; float:left; margin-right:10px;}
.top5 h5{ color:#a0a0a0; padding-bottom:5px; font-size:14px;}
.top5 h1{ color:#0063de; font-size:25px;}

/*导航条*/
.nav{ width:100%; float:left; background:url(../images/nav.jpg) repeat-x; height:48px;}
.nav ul{ width:900px; margin:0 auto;}
.nav ul li{ width:101px; height:48px; color:#fff; line-height:48px; font-size:15px; float:left; text-align:center; margin-right:48px;}
.nav ul li a{ color:#fff; display:block;}
.nav ul li a:hover{ color:#fff; background:url(../images/nav1.jpg) no-repeat bottom; text-decoration:none;}
.nav .hover{ color:#fff; background:url(../images/nav1.jpg) no-repeat bottom; text-decoration:none;}


/*大图*/
#banner{ width:100%; float:left; height:300px;}
.banner{ width:1003px; margin:0 auto;overflow:hidden;}


#xxb{ width:100%; float:left; margin-top:30px;}
.xxb{ width:1003px; margin: 0 auto; }

/*新闻动态*/
.xxb1{ width:381px; float:left; margin-right:23px;}
.xxb2{ width:100%; height:20px; float:left;}
.xxb2 span{ width:5px; height:20px; background:#004fb6; float:left; margin-right:5px;}
.xxb2 h5{ color:#004fb6; padding-top:3px;float:left; font-size:17px;}
.xxb2 h6{ color:#fa9d1e; font-size:12px; float:right; padding-top:8px;}
.xxb2 h6 a{ color:#fa9d1e;}
.xxb3{ width:381px; float:left; background:#f5f5f5; margin-top:10px; overflow:hidden;}
.xxb3 div{ width:340px; margin:0 auto; margin-top:20px; }
.xxb3 div span{ width:90px; height:88px; float:left; margin-right:10px;}
.xxb3 div h5{ color:#555; line-height:22px; font-size:12px; }
.xxb3 div p{ color:#004fb6; padding-bottom:10px; font-size:13px; font-weight:bold;}
.xxb3 ul{ width:340px; float:left; padding-top:5px;}
.xxb3 ul li h1{ width:3px; height:3px; float:left; margin-right:10px; background:#fa9d1e; margin-top:15px;}
.xxb3 ul li h2{ color:#343434; line-height:35px; float:right; font-size:13px;}
.xxb3 ul li{ width:340px; height:35px; float:left; border-bottom:#e0e0e0 dashed 1px; color:#343434; line-height:35px; font-size:13px; }
.xxb3 ul li a{ color:#343434; }
.xxb3 ul li a:hover{ color:#fa9d1e;}
.xxb4{ float:left;}


.xxb5{ width:301px; float:left;}
.xxb6{ width:301px; float:left; background:#f5f5f5; margin-top:10px; overflow:hidden;}
.xxb6 div{ width:264px; margin:0 auto; margin-top:20px;}
.xxb6 div span{ width:264px; height:97px; }
.xxb6 div p{ color:#555; line-height:19px; font-size:12px; margin-bottom:21px; margin-top:10px;}

.xxb7{ width:277px; float:right;}
.xxb8{ width:277px; float:left; margin-top:10px; background:#f5f5f5;}
.xxb8 div{ width:245px; margin:0 auto; margin-top:20px;}
.xxb8 div p{ color:#555; line-height:18px; font-size:12px;}
.xxb9{width:276px; height:82px; float:left; margin-top:15px;}

.xxb0{ width:1003px; float:left; margin-top:20px;}
.xxb01{ width:1003px; float:left; height:240px; background:url(../images/xxb3.jpg) no-repeat; margin-top:20px;}
.xxb02{ width:22px; float:left; height:240px; }
.xxb02 a{ width:22px; height:41px; float:left;margin-top:97px;}
.xxb03{ width:22px; float:right; height:240px; }
.xxb03 a{ width:22px; height:41px; float:left;margin-top:97px;}
.xxb04{ float:left; padding-top:35px;height: 182px;}
.xxb04 a{ width:165px; float:left; margin-right:18px;}
.xxb04 a p{ color:#004fb6; line-height:30px; font-size:13px; text-align:center;}


#ny{ width:100%; float:left;background:#fff; border-bottom:#e7e7e7 solid 1px; overflow:hidden;}
.ny{ width:1003px; margin:0 auto; margin-top:30px; }
.ny1{ width:242px; float:left;}
.ny2{ width:242px; height:42px; border-bottom:#004fb6 solid 4px; float:left;}
.ny2 p{ color:#004fb6; line-height:42px; float:left; font-family: "微软雅黑"; font-weight:normal; margin-right:10px; font-size:20px;}
.ny2 h3{ color:#696969; line-height:42px; float:left; font-size:17px; text-transform:uppercase; font-weight:normal;}
.ny4{ width:200px; height:42px; float:right;}
.ny4 p{ color:#7b7b7b; line-height:42px; float:right; float:right; font-size:13px;}
.ny4 p a{ color:#7b7b7b;}
.ny4 p a:hover{ color:#004fb6;}

#ny3{ width:100%; float:left; overflow:hidden; background:#fff;}
.ny5{ width:1003px; margin:0 auto;}
.ny6{ width:242px; float:left;}
.ny3{ width:242px; float:left;}

.ny3 ul li{ width:242px; height:47px; background:url(../images/ny3.jpg) no-repeat;  line-height:47px; font-size:12px; text-indent:2em; float:left;}
.ny3 ul li a{ color:#4d4d4d; display:block;}
.ny3 ul li a:hover{ color:#004fb6; line-height:47px; font-size:14px; background:url(../images/ny2.jpg) no-repeat; text-decoration:none;}
.ny3 .hover{ color:#004fb6; line-height:47px; font-size:12px; background:url(../images/ny2.jpg) no-repeat; text-decoration:none;}

.ny7{ width:242px; height:452px; background:url(../images/ny1.jpg) no-repeat; float:left; margin-top:30px; padding-bottom:50px;}
.ny7 a{ width:242px; float:left;}



.ny8{ width:700px; float:right;}
.ny8 p{ width:700px;  color:#3f3f3f; line-height:57px; font-family:"微软雅黑"; font-size:20px; float:left;}
.ny8 li{ line-height:25px;}
.ny8 li a:hover{color:#fa9d1e;}
.ny8 h3{ width:666px; float:left; color:#555; margin-top:30px; font-size:13px; line-height:30px; font-weight:normal;}
.right{ float:right}


#bq{ width:100%; height:80px; float:left; margin-top:40px; background:#393939; overflow:hidden;}
.bq{ width:1003px; height:80px; margin:0 auto;}
.bq p{ color:#fff; line-height:80px; font-size:12px; float:left;}
.bq p a{ color:#fff;}

.bq h5{ color:#fff; line-height:80px; font-size:12px; float:right;}
.bq h5 a{ color:#fff;}


/**产品平铺展示的**/
.cup0 {width: 730px;float: left;margin-top: 20px;}
.lol-99 {float: left; margin-top: 30px;text-align: center; margin-right:30px; width:202px;}
.cup0 p {color: #555;line-height: 30px;font-size: 12px;font-weight: normal;}
.ny80{ float:right; width:700px;}
.ny80 p{width: 700px;height: 57px;color: #3F3F3F;line-height: 57px;font-family: "微软雅黑";font-size: 20px;float: left;}
.lol-99 span{height: 57px;color: #3F3F3F;line-height: 30px;font-family: "微软雅黑";}
#ny3 .ny5 .ny6 div div p {line-height: 35px;border-bottom: 1px dashed #E0E0E0;}
.contact p{border-bottom: 1px dashed #E0E0E0; padding-left:20px;}

/*在线留言*/
input, button, select {border: 1px solid #999;color: #666;line-height: 22px;margin: 3px 0px;height: 22px;
}
button, input, select, textarea {font-size: 100%;}
textarea {font-family: "微软雅黑";color: #000;border: 1px solid #999;}
